For 150 guests, you need a dance floor of about 225–675 square feet depending on participation rate and dance style. With moderate participation (33%) and general mixed dancing at 4.5 sq ft per person, that is 50 dancers needing 225 sq ft — a 15×15 ft floor. For heavy participation (50%), size up to an 18×18 ft floor.
| Guests | Light (25%) | Moderate (33%) | Heavy (50%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 75 | 9×9 ft | 12×12 ft | 15×15 ft |
| 150 | 12×12 ft | 15×15 ft | 18×18 ft |
| 200 | 15×15 ft | 18×18 ft | 21×21 ft |
| 300 | 18×18 ft | 21×21 ft | 24×24 ft |
Space per dancer depends on dance style. General mixed dancing needs about 4.5 sq ft per person. Slow dancing requires only 3 sq ft, while energetic line dancing needs 6 sq ft and formal ballroom dancing needs 9 sq ft per couple. The industry standard for event planning is 4–5 sq ft per dancer.
Typically 25–50% of wedding guests dance at any given time. A moderate estimate is 33% (one-third). Factors include music quality, open bar availability, crowd energy, and time of night. For a 150-person wedding, expect 38–75 people on the floor simultaneously.
The number of 3×3 ft panels depends on your total floor area. A 15×15 ft floor needs 25 panels (5×5 grid). An 18×18 ft floor needs 36 panels (6×6 grid). Rental companies typically charge $5–15 per panel, so a 15×15 ft floor costs about $125–375 to rent.
